SCTM003 - Overview

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: SCTM - Central Context Management

  • Message number: 003

  • Message text: Save error. Context object type not saved...

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message SCTM003 - Save error. Context object type not saved... ?
    The SAP error message SCTM003, which states "Save error. Context object type not saved," typically occurs in the context of SAP Solution Manager or when working with SAP Change Management. This error indicates that there was an issue saving a context object type, which could be due to various reasons.
    Possible Causes:
    
    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to save the context object.
    Data Integrity Issues: There may be inconsistencies or missing data in the context object that prevent it from being saved.
    Technical Errors: There could be a technical issue with the SAP system, such as a database error or a problem with the application server.
    
    Configuration Issues: The system configuration may not be set up correctly for the context object type being saved.
